Automotive OEMs are perpetually trying to save weight and cut costs. Moving to 48V will provide ample opportunities to save on both. However, automakers realize they have to bring their entire supply chain along with them and carefully count the costs and map their plan. Vicor has the technology to add high-density power converters modules to make the transition from 12V – 48V painless, easy and efficient.
